About 3 Lathom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Lathom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Liverpool (L21 1EB). It has a recorded floor area of 88 m² (around 947 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2026) shows a C (score 73). This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.

It hasn't traded since September 1995, a hold of 31 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£138,000 sits 258.4% above the 1995 sale of £38,500. At 88 m² it's 17.8%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(107 m² median across 3 EPCs).
